Played the Demo version just this weeked. LOVE IT. That coming from a man who never saw IV, could not stand I, wasn't a big fan of II and couldn't get used to the changes in III. The game is awesomely well-balanced, the battles far more dynamic and challenging then those I saw in the previous parts of the series (they also require far more strategic thinking), the way heroes function is very well thought out, too. I love the challenge the difficulty level presents, the graphics are good (IMO, they are a very good re-making of HOM&MII/III graphics style into 3-D). Also, there was a bit of surprise in for me... you see, once you have a closer look at the whole thing, there is a number of things that feel heavily inspired by Warhammer Fantasy Battles - not that it's bad, quite good actually - and so everyone who likes the Warhammer world will quickly find themselves in Heroes V as well.
